11 PhD positions, Frankfurt University

Call for 11 PhD-positions

The graduate school

Value and Equivalence. The genesis and transformation of values from an archaeological and anthropological perspective"

offers

11 PhD-positions (funding for 2 years with a possible extension by a third year)to start at 01.04.2010

The graduate school, which is based at the Goethe Universität Frankfurt am Main and the Technische Universität Darmstadt, focuses on concepts of value and equivalence in relation to material culture in a broad geographical and chronological framework.

The call includes

- 1 PhD-position in Archaeology and Cultural History of the Near East
- 1 PhD-position in Cuneiform Studies
- 1 PhD-position in Classical Archaeology at the Goethe Universität Frankfurt am Main
- 1 PhD-position in Classical Archaeology at the Technische Universität Darmstadt
- 2 PhD-positions in Archaeology and History of the Roman provinces /Auxiliary sciences (Epigraphy, Numismatics, Papyrology)
- 1 PhD-position in Prehistory of Europe
- 1 PhD-position in Prehistory of Africa
- 3 PhD-positions in Social Anthropology, centring on Africa, North-America and Southeast Asia resp.

The PhD-positions consist of a monthly stipend of EUR 1200, plus expenses and family and/or children allowances (where eligible).
